    Question Can I use a Vibram sole in alpine binding with AFD???

    I bought some slightly uses Sugar Daddys for € 250 They are fitted with Atomic 614 binder which look alot like these They have AFD which works in the same way as Fritschi's. I normally ski on Garmont adrinalines which have a vibram sole. I know the sole can be changed but that a pain in the ass to do. Will the binding release properly with the Vibram sole????

    After putting vibrams on my alpine boots, it raised them too high to fit in some bindings. So I sanded them. Fucked me up when I didn't adjust my freeride toe height first day of the season once and did a couple somersaults before they released. If you're as lame as me, you could get hurt.
